Even President Obama has had time to take notice of Carson Wentz's impressive performance in Week 1 of the young NFL season.

Tuesday, in an address to a crowd in Philadelphia, President Obama made mention of Eagles' rookie starting quarterback, Carson Wentz.

"Joe Biden told me, 'Barack, you gotta get on the Wentz Wagon.' I said I am a Bears fan," the president said on a speech carried live on multiple national news outlets.

The line was met with both laughter and boos, all in support of the rookie quarterback from Bismarck. The 2nd overall pick in the NFL draft had a stellar debut, going 22 of 37 for 278 yards and 2 touchdowns in a 29-10 victory in Philadelphia, over the Cleveland Browns.

Vice President Joe Biden was in attendance at the Eagles' home opener. Next up for Wentz and the Eagles is the Chicago Bears on Monday night in Chicago.
